FAQ


- Typically, annual calibration is recommended, but calibration intervals may vary based on frequency of use, application criticality, and operating conditions. High-use or critical process transducers may require more frequent calibration (e.g., semi-annually or quarterly).


- You should calibrate if:
- The transducer is used in a critical process and the calibration period has elapsed.
- There is an observed drift or inaccuracy in readings.
- The sensor has been exposed to overpressure, shock, or extreme thermal conditions.
- Regulatory/compliance standards require documentation of calibration.
- There are changes in process output quality that suggest measurement errors.
